Output 95ffbff38e7fa3292b83b545a2a215b208fe18bb97648a34ecbb9eb3c9a2c93a:0

value
897315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ab8581498add365280010c3ecbad41dec336e43 OP_EQUAL
address
3QYhgx958hYFeY5CG4SsnDRVNN6Nm7r4nh
transaction
95ffbff38e7fa3292b83b545a2a215b208fe18bb97648a34ecbb9eb3c9a2c93a
confirmations
263474
spent
true